Blemain parent group changes name to Together
Jerrold Holdings, the parent company of Blemain Finance and Cheshire Mortgage Corporation, has changed its name to Together.

The Together brand covers the group’s separate companies which offer loans in different areas of the specialist lending market which include Auction Finance, Bridging Finance and Lancashire Mortgage Corporation.

Board director Marc Goldberg said the group had accumulated a lot of different brand names in its 40 years’ of trading.

Goldberg said the company’s central proposition remained the same across all its products which was to take an individual approach to each case.

The company’s expansion has been fuelled by increased funding with current facilities of £1.25bn. For the year ending June 2015, the company achieved profit before tax of £70.1m and has a loan book in excess of £1.4bn.

The staff headcount has increased by 12% in 12 months bringing the workforce to 390 employees.

The company has changed its brand and website to support its new image.
